Which type of cathedral had stained-glass windows that helped explain Christian teachings and other architectural features that reminded people to look to God? A. Byzantine B. Greco-Roman C. Gothic D. Romanesque This one is C. Gothic :P

OpenStudy (anonymous):

Yes, gothic cathedrals had stained glass windows for people who couldn't read, which was a common thing back in the Middle Ages.

OpenStudy (anonymous):

The stained glass windows would show stories from the bible
